my 6 week old is female she has a rash on her checks, chin, and neck. it is causing light spots on her chin and checks. her skin is very dry. I have Eczema do you think she could have it to.
|
| Dr. Chan Lowe
- Sun Apr 01, 2007 5:10 am |
It is possible that she has Eczema. It may also be "baby Acne". The light spots may be post-inflammatory hypopigmentation that will return to normal color over time.
I would recommend that your daughter be seen by her pediatrician to take a look at the rash. She should have a regular check up coming up soon. You can probably wait until then unless you are concerned.
